FormsAuthentication.RequireSSL Proprietà
Importante
Alcune informazioni sono relative alla release non definitiva del prodotto, che potrebbe subire modifiche significative prima della release definitiva. Microsoft non riconosce alcuna garanzia, espressa o implicita, in merito alle informazioni qui fornite.
Ottiene un valore che indica se il cookie di autenticazione basata su form richiede SSL per essere restituito al server.
public:
static property bool RequireSSL { bool get(); };
public static bool RequireSSL { get; }
static member RequireSSL : bool
Public Shared ReadOnly Property RequireSSL As Boolean
true
se è richiesta la crittografia SSL per restituire il cookie di autenticazione basata su form al server; in caso contrario, false
. Il valore predefinito è false
.
Nell'esempio di codice seguente viene impostato l'attributo requireSSL
nel file Web.config.
<authentication mode="Forms">
<forms loginUrl="member_login.aspx"
cookieless="UseCookies"
requireSSL="true"
path="/MyApplication" />
</authentication>
Il RequireSSL valore della proprietà viene impostato nel file di configurazione per un'applicazione ASP.NET usando l'attributo dell'elemento requireSSL
di configurazione dei moduli . È possibile specificare nel file di Web.config per l'applicazione ASP.NET se è necessario SSL (Secure Sockets Layer) per restituire il cookie di autenticazione form al server impostando l'attributo requireSSL
. Per altre informazioni, vedere Secure.
È consigliabile configurare requireSSL
come false
false
, anche come slidingExpiration
, per ridurre la quantità di tempo per cui un ticket è valido.
Prodotto | Versioni |
---|---|
.NET Framework | 1.1, 2.0, 3.0, 3.5, 4.0, 4.5, 4.5.1, 4.5.2, 4.6, 4.6.1, 4.6.2, 4.7, 4.7.1, 4.7.2, 4.8, 4.8.1 |
Feedback su .NET
.NET è un progetto open source. Seleziona un collegamento per fornire feedback: